絞り込み条件を変更する
検索条件を絞り込む

すべてのカテゴリ

4 件中 1 - 4 件表示
カバー画像

Facebook投稿支援アプリにReact/Vueは必要か (6)?

Facebook投稿支援アプリにReact/Vueは必要か (6)?WebアプリやWebサービスを開発するのにフレームワークがどこまで必要なのかをシンプルなアプリを例にして考える企画を実施しています。 これまでに、HTMLファイルをベースとした実装例として、シンプルなHTMLとJavascript、jQuery、CDNをベースにしたReactとVueの実装例を紹介してきました。前回の記事でまとめたように、ReactやVueを使う場合、「npm」を利用してReactやVueのプロジェクトを作成して開発した方が便利です。ReactやVueを利用した開発の殆どは、CDNではなく、「npm」が利用されています。この記事では、「npm」を利用したReactの実装例を紹介しています。パッケージを管理する「npm」Node.jsをインストールすると、合わせてインストールされるのが「npm」というパッケージ管理ツールです。このツールを利用すると、インターネット上で公開されているNode.js(Javascript)のパッケージを自分のWebアプリやサービスに取り込んで簡単に利用できます。少し規模の大きなWebアプリやサービスの場合、そうした既存の公開されているパッケージを利用できるので開発の効率が向上します。もちろん、CDN(Contents Delivery Network)で、HTMLファイルから読み込めばこうしたパッケージも利用できるのですが、規模が大きなアプリやサービスの場合、npmで取り込んでしまった方が便利です。Node.jsは、オフィシャルサイトからダウンロードして簡単にインスト
0
カバー画像

Telegram Botを簡単に作りたい方へ:3つの失敗から生まれた「最小限コスト」の実装方法

こんにちは。Stephenです。今日は、私が約1年かけて開発した「Telegram Bot制作の最適なやり方」についてお話ししたいと思います。同じような悩みを持つ方の参考になれば幸いです。 きっかけ:シアヌークビルのビジネスディレクトリを作りたかった シアヌークビルという小さな街の中華系コミュニティのために、Telegram上でレストラン、ホテル、サービスなどをさっと検索できるBot を作りたいと思いました。 「簡単なことだ」と思っていました。 でも現実は…甘くなかった。 最初の試行錯誤:3つのツールを試して、3度挫折した1番目:Botmother(見た目は完璧、中身は…) Botmotherというツールは、ドラッグ&ドロップでBotが作れます。とても優しいUIで、2週間でメニュー全体を完成させました。 「これで完璧だ!」と思ったのですが… 詳細ページを作ろうとした瞬間、壁にぶつかりました。 このツールは「固定的な内容」には強いのですが、データベースから動的に情報を取得して表示するという機能に対応していなかったのです。 ここでの学び: 可視化ツールは便利だけど、複雑なデータ処理には向かない。 2番目:ManyChat(高くて、複雑だった) 次に試したのはManyChat。機能は確かに豊富です。 でも年間$1,500以上の費用がかかる。さらに、ユーザーをメニュー間で移動させるロジックを作るのに、数時間もかかりました。 「これって…過剰に複雑じゃないか?」と気づきました。 ここでの学び: 高いツール=最適なツールとは限らない。 3番目:Google Apps Script(
0
カバー画像

保守性の高いきれいなコード

CSS設計を学ぶ保守性が高く、きれいなコーディングができるように。BEMはSassと相性が良いので、身につければきれいなコードで今より短時間で記述できるようになるだろう
0
カバー画像

日報:2025/09/21 【保守性あげる工夫いろいろ&プログラミングは未来の時間を買うロマン??】

✅できた・コーディング作業コツコツ ・ウォーキング8409歩 💡学んだ ・ulなんかで、画像に通し番号振って、○○-01.webp~... とかの要素を作るとき、PHPのfor文使うとコード記述量もめっちゃ減って、保守性もかなりアップ imgのaltも配列にして渡してやれば問題なし ・template-partsで、fvなんかのパーツを作るとき、HTMLの方にstyle属性つけてbackground-imageを変数でわたしてやれるようにすれば、保守性ガンアップ ・ボックスの中のテキストをスクロールして読めるようにするのは、overflow-y: scroll; でめちゃ簡単 📍次やる ・しばらくは、楽しいコーディング作業 🐶雑談  コード書いてて、いかに保守性をあげるか?? って工夫するところに快感を見出してしまいます... 個人的にプログラミング言語全般が好きなのは、人間がいかにズボラをするか? に頭を使うところです いま、頭と工夫と少しの手間を使って、 未来の膨大な時間を買う... ロマン??もあるかも??笑 まあ、けっこう多くの案件で、一回コード書いたら、将来手直しすることあまりなかったりするんで、 ほんと、自己満足なんですけどね...笑
0
4 件中 1 - 4